

This tea originates from the mountainous Yunnan province located in China near the border with Vietnam, Burma and Laos. The tea plant is characterized by wide and fleshy leaves with a glossy surface. The lighter-colored leaves (known as tips) are clearly visible in the dried tea. The infusion is characterized by its brown color, intense, distinctive aroma and aftertaste. It is a rather strong, astringent in taste tea.
